Ingredients for Your Cheap Breakfast
- 2 large eggs
- 1 slice of whole grain bread
- 1 tablespoon unsalted butter
- Salt to taste
- Pepper to taste

How to Prepare Your Cheap Breakfast
- Start by heating the unsalted butter in a non-stick pan over medium heat. This is where the magic begins! Just wait until it’s nice and melted, and you’ll see a little bubbling action.
- Next, crack the 2 large eggs directly into the pan. Don’t worry if a little shell slips in—just fish it out with a spoon. Trust me, it happens to the best of us!
- Sprinkle some salt and pepper over the eggs to season them to your taste. This is where they really start to shine!
- Let the eggs cook for about 2-3 minutes. You want the whites to be set but the yolks still a bit runny, unless you prefer them cooked through. Just keep an eye on them so they don’t overcook!
- While the eggs are sizzling away, pop your slice of whole grain bread into the toaster. You want it golden brown and crispy to hold those delicious eggs.
- Once the eggs are cooked to your liking, gently slide them onto the toasted bread. Wow, what a sight!
- Serve your creation hot and enjoy every tasty bite of this quick and satisfying breakfast!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
If you happen to have leftovers from your cheap breakfast, don’t worry! Simply let the eggs and toast cool down to room temperature. Then, store them in an airtight container in the fridge. They should be good for about 1-2 days.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, just pop the toast in the toaster for a quick crisp up and reheat the eggs gently in the microwave for about 20-30 seconds. Just be careful not to overheat them, or they might get a bit rubbery! Enjoy those tasty bites again without any hassle!
